Where is Hampton Coliseum?
Where is Hampton Coliseum located?
Hampton Coliseum, Virginia, United States (approx. 37.03472°, -76.38139°)
Where is Hampton Coliseum on the map?
{"latitude":37.03472,"longitude":-76.38139,"title":"Hampton Coliseum"}